What makes the greatest ore, tho? Sulfides crystallize at higher temperatures and have simpler molecular structures. Sulfosalts precipitate at lower temperatures, have greater solubility, plus bonus semi-metals. I’m voting for the sulfosalt, #Tetrahedrite.

A pseudomorph (false form) is when one mineral changes to another, but keeps the original form. #copper
